Introduction
- Strong Market Outlook Through 2032: The global sterilization equipment market, valued at approximately USD 17.6 billion in 2024, is expected to surpass USD 33 billion by 2032. This notable growth reflects heightened global emphasis on infection control and hygiene standards.
- Healthy CAGR Underscores Rising Demand: With a projected CAGR of around 8.3% from 2024 to 2032, the market is driven by increasing healthcare infrastructure investments, stringent regulatory mandates, and the growing need for safe medical device reprocessing.
- Innovation and Healthcare Expansion Fueling Growth: Advancements in low-temperature sterilization technologies, widespread adoption of automated sterilizers, and expanding applications in pharmaceuticals, food processing, and biotechnology are propelling market expansion worldwide.
VRIO Analysis – Global Sterilization Equipment Market
- Valuable: The global sterilization equipment market derives strong value from advanced technologies such as low-temperature systems, hydrogen peroxide plasma, and UV-C sterilization, which play a critical role in reducing hospital-acquired infections and ensuring patient safety. The increasing demand for efficient sterilization in healthcare, pharmaceuticals, and food industries—especially in the post-pandemic era—further enhances the value of these solutions. Integration with automation and digital monitoring systems also adds value by improving operational efficiency and regulatory compliance.
- Rare: Proprietary technologies and patented systems for complex sterilization needs are relatively rare and are typically held by a few leading players. Companies with unique expertise in areas such as ozone-based sterilization, AI-driven cycle optimization, or custom equipment for high-risk instruments gain a competitive edge due to their scarcity in the broader market. Access to advanced research capabilities and exclusive collaborations also contributes to this rarity.
- Imitable: While basic sterilization equipment can be copied, advanced, high-performance systems featuring intelligent controls, fast cycle times, and superior energy efficiency are more challenging to replicate. Additionally, securing regulatory approvals like FDA, CE, or ISO certifications takes time and resources, which limits immediate imitation. Established companies also benefit from long-standing brand credibility and strategic partnerships that are not easily duplicated by new entrants.
- Organized to Capture Value: Market leaders are well-organized to leverage their strengths, with global supply chains, responsive technical support, and dedicated R&D centers. Many are aligned with public health initiatives and procurement contracts, enabling them to capture consistent value across regions. Furthermore, investments in digital sterilization solutions, IoT integration, and post-sale services ensure a strong competitive position and recurring revenue streams.

Frequently Asked Questions
Why is sterilization equipment becoming the unsung hero of global healthcare systems in 2025?
With rising concerns over HAIs (Hospital-Acquired Infections) and antibiotic resistance, sterilization equipment is now essential for infection prevention protocols. Hospitals, labs, and even pharma plants are investing heavily to meet rigorous global hygiene mandates.
What are the hottest technologies disrupting the sterilization equipment market right now?
In 2025, the market is shifting toward low-temperature hydrogen peroxide systems, plasma sterilizers, and UV-C light-based solutions. These are faster, eco-friendlier, and instrument-safe, replacing legacy autoclaves in many high-precision applications.
Which industries are expanding the use of sterilization equipment beyond healthcare?
Sterilization is no longer just for hospitals. It's now mission-critical in food processing, biotech labs, aesthetic clinics, pharmaceuticals, and even semiconductor manufacturing, where particle-free surfaces are vital.
Who are the major buyers and how is their demand shaping global growth?
Key buyers include multispecialty hospitals, dental clinics, diagnostic centers, OEMs in life sciences, and contract sterilization providers. Their growing demand for modular, digital, and scalable equipment is accelerating product innovation and aftermarket services.
Which regions are driving the sterilization surge, and what’s fueling their growth?
North America leads with high hospital investments and stringent FDA standards. Europe follows with eco-friendly tech adoption and strict regulatory pressure. Asia-Pacific is the fastest-growing, fueled by medical tourism, new hospitals, and pandemic-preparedness infrastructure in India, China, and Southeast Asia.
